Role Description
Creates user-centered experiences and interfaces for products and solutions which improves end-to-end user journeys. Develops the overall design and specifications for creating and enhancing the experience and functionality of user interfaces for company products. Uses design tools to create storyboards, wireframes, prototypes, information architecture diagrams and user journey maps for demonstrations and user testing.
Produces high-fidelity designs for implementation by development teams. Analyze user research, business insights and other data to continuously improve customer experiences. Reviews proposed product changes or enhancements for compliance and alignment with desired user experience design and satisfaction standards and suggests improvements. Creates and maintains UI/UX resources such as content templates, samples and guidelines, to streamline the design process for designers and developers.

We back our colleagues with the support they need to thrive, professionally and personally. That's why we have Amex Flex, our enterprise working model that provides greater flexibility to colleagues while ensuring we preserve the important aspects of our unique in-person culture. Depending on role and business needs, colleagues will either work onsite, in a hybrid model (combination of in-office and virtual days) or fully virtually.
